§ 3-307.
  (a)   In the performance of official duties, a health officer may enter and inspect any private house if the health officer:
    (1)   Has obtained consent to enter and inspect;
    (2)   Has obtained a warrant; or
    (3)   Does not have time or opportunity to obtain a warrant and an exceptional or emergency situation exists.
  (b)   In the performance of official duties, a health officer may enter any place of business or employment.
